What Is SCHD?
SCHD is created to track the efficiency of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index, which focuses on high-dividend yielding U.S. companies with a strong history of dividend payments. By purchasing a diversified swimming pool of stocks, SCHD permits investors to profit of dividends while maintaining lower danger compared to specific stock financial investments.

1. What is the average dividend yield for SCHD?

The typical dividend yield for SCHD normally hovers around 3-4%. However, this can vary based upon market conditions and management decisions.

2. Can I input different reinvestment rates?

Yes, lots of calculators allow users to input various reinvestment rates, assisting you see different circumstances based on how much income you select to reinvest.

3. Exist charges associated with SCHD?

Like any ETF, SCHD has management costs, referred to as the cost ratio, which for schd monthly dividend calculator is relatively low at around 0.06%. This means that for every single ₤ 1,000 invested, about ₤ 0.60 goes to management expenses.

4. Does SCHD have a history of trusted dividends?

Yes, SCHD has a strong track record of consistent dividend payments and is known for increasing dividends each year, making it an attractive alternative for income-focused investors.
